Andrew Wyeth, R.I.P.
Photo: Courtesy of the Museum of Modern Art
Andrew Wyeth, whose Helga portraits and Christina's World are among the best-known American artworks of the twentieth Century, passed away this morning at the age of 91. We don't know about you, but we'll be braving the cold and heading over to MoMA this weekend to pay our respects. [USAT]
